In February, Zdiar, Slovakia, experiences a dramatic range of temperatures, with a maximum of 14°C (58°F) and a minimum plunging to -18°C (0°F), resulting in an average of -2°C (29°F). This month witnesses approximately 56 mm (2.2 in) of precipitation spread across 14 days, contributing to a humid atmosphere with humidity levels reaching 88%. February in Zdiar, Slovakia, marks a noticeable increase in precipitation, with 56 mm (2.2 in) of rain recorded over 14 days. This uptick from January's 35 mm (1.4 in) underscores a shift toward wetter winter conditions. Unlike the preceding month, February often brings a blend of rain and snow, adding to the region's picturesque landscape. As winter gradually yields to spring, the precipitation levels indicate the beginning of a transition, setting the stage for the even wetter months ahead, such as April and May, when Zdiar typically experiences its peak rainfall. In February, Zdiar, Slovakia, experiences a slight dip in humidity, averaging 88%, down from a rainy 91% in January. This gradual decrease marks the beginning of a trend towards more moderate moisture levels as the region transitions from winter to spring. Following February, humidity continues to decline, hitting 86% in March and dropping further to 77% in April. This seasonal shift not only reflects a changing landscape but also sets the stage for drier months ahead, with May and June showcasing even lower humidity levels at 69%. In February, Zdiar, Slovakia experiences a notable increase in daylight, averaging 10 hours compared to the 8 hours in January. This upward trend marks the beginning of a gradual transition towards spring, as daylight steadily lengthens with each passing month. Following February, March enjoys 11 hours, and by April, daylight extends to a delightful 13 hours, allowing for more outdoor activities and vibrant scenery. This pattern continues into the summer months, peaking at 16 hours in June before gently tapering off into the autumn and winter months, where daylight dwindles back to 8 hours by December. In comparing the weather of February to January, February generally experiences milder temperatures, with a minimum of -18°C (0°F), an average of -2°C (29°F), and a maximum of 14°C (58°F). This is a notable improvement over January, which sees much colder conditions with a minimum of -27°C (-15°F), an average of -4°C (25°F), and a maximum of only 6°C (43°F). Additionally, February is wetter, receiving 56 mm (2.2 in) of precipitation over 14 days, while January has less precipitation at 35 mm (1.4 in) over 10 days.
